NHTSA RQ22001: Recall 22E-016

Make: PONY.AI. Model: AUTOMATED DRIVING SYSTEM. Component: ELECTRICAL SYSTEM:ADAS:AUTONOMOUS/SELF DRIVING. The Office of Defects Investigation (ODI) opened Recall Query RQ22-001 to evaluate the scope and remedy of Recall 22E-016. Recall 22E-016 addressed a defect causing the Automated Driving System (ADS) to shut down on a vehicle that was being operated by Pony.ai in a driverless mode.
